Grade CU5MCuC Nickel vs. Grey Cast Iron

Grade CU5MCuC nickel belongs to the nickel alloys classification, while grey cast iron belongs to the iron alloys. They have a modest 31% of their average alloy composition in common, which, by itself, doesn't mean much. There are 24 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(9,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is grade CU5MCuC nickel and the bottom bar is grey cast iron.
